Comfort for one of my daughters, when I have gone home.
If I die and never see tomorrow,
Always carry in your heart and mind and remember that I loved you.

And when tomorrow comes and someone tells you that I have died, try to hold your head up high and not cry for me, because I went home to our Father.

Then, weeks later you still find yourself crying for me, open your heart and mind and try to understand that God didn't take me away from you.

He took me home because I had fulfilled my mission here on Earth; and that mission had been to love you.
